This local spotlight is a peninsula of unspoilt Suffolk squeezed between the rivers Orwell and Stour. A sailors paradise and a walker's welcome, Shotley peninsular has lots to explore. This light and soft Fog Pale with Citra, El Dorado and Azacca hops gives a melody of tropical fruits perfect to explore the many beauties this peninsula has to offer.

Appearance - 8 | Aroma - 7.5 | Flavor - 7 | Texture - 7 | Overall - 7.5
Tap at hopsters Woodbridge. A translucent yellow straw coloured pour with a fine white head. Aroma is semi sweet, Fanta, orange creamsicle, vanilla, peach melba.. Flavour is composed of rounded wheaty grains, orange rind, spicy citrus, not bad. Palate is light chalky, drying finish, highish carbonation. Prickly.
